Indianapolis water from Citizens Energy runs at 17 grains per gallon, a level the US Geological Survey classifies as very hard. It also contains chloramines used for disinfection, disinfection byproducts including trihalomethanes and haloacetic acids, and trace chromium-6 flagged in the annual Consumer Confidence Report. A whole home water filter addresses the chemical treatment side: carbon-based media captures chloramines, byproducts, and taste and odor compounds before they reach your fixtures. A water softener handles the hardness separately, protecting appliances and plumbing from scale. Most Indianapolis homeowners who care about both protection and water quality run both systems in the same utility room, with a reverse osmosis unit under the kitchen sink for drinking water. Citizens Energy Group serves most of Indianapolis and portions of Hamilton County. Their source water comes from the White River, Eagle Creek Reservoir, and Geist Reservoir. The treatment process involves coagulation, sedimentation, filtration, and disinfection using chloramines (a combination of chlorine and ammonia) rather than free chlorine, which produces a different byproduct profile.
At your tap in 2026, Indianapolis municipal water typically carries:
- Hardness: 16 to 19 GPG depending on the neighborhood and season, with most central Indianapolis readings around 17 GPG.
- Chloramines: the primary disinfectant. Gives water the faint chemical smell many residents notice, particularly in summer.
- Trihalomethanes (TTHMs): disinfection byproducts formed when chlorine-based treatment reacts with organic matter in source water. Flagged in Citizens Energy's Consumer Confidence Reports.
- Haloacetic acids (HAAs): a second class of disinfection byproducts. Also flagged in CCR data at detectable levels.
- Chromium-6: detected in the distribution system at trace levels. Listed in the most recent Consumer Confidence Report. No federal Maximum Contaminant Level exists for chromium-6 specifically, though total chromium is regulated.
- Nitrates: detected at low levels in agricultural-adjacent zones on the east side of Marion County.
None of these represent a compliance failure. Indianapolis water meets all federal Safe Drinking Water Act standards. But meeting the legal standard is not the same as ideal tap water, and many Indianapolis homeowners choose to treat for the specific contaminants that concern them. What whole home filtration addresses
A whole home water filtration system, typically installed on the main supply line after the meter, treats every drop of water entering the house before it reaches any fixture. Most residential systems use a multi-stage approach:
- 01
Sediment pre-filter
A 5 to 20 micron polypropylene cartridge captures particulates: rust, sand, silt, and scale fragments. This protects the carbon media downstream from fouling and extends its service life.
- 02
Activated carbon stage
Carbon media, either granular activated carbon (GAC) or a solid carbon block, adsorbs chlorine, chloramines, TTHMs, HAAs, and organic taste and odor compounds. Catalytic carbon handles chloramines better than standard GAC, which matters specifically for Indianapolis because Citizens Energy uses chloramine disinfection rather than free chlorine.
- 03
Post-filter or UV stage (optional)
Some systems add a post-filter for fine particulates or a UV purifier that deactivates bacteria and viruses. UV is more common for well-water homes than municipal supply, but it is an option for Indianapolis homeowners who want an additional layer of protection.
What whole home filtration does not address: hardness. Carbon filtration does not remove calcium or magnesium. A home at 17 GPG remains at 17 GPG after a carbon whole home filter. If scale on appliances is a concern (and at 17 GPG it should be), a water softener is a separate requirement. Filtration vs softening
The most common question we get from Indianapolis homeowners is whether they need a water softener, a whole home filter, or both. The answer depends on which problems you are trying to solve.
| Problem | Water softener | Whole home filter |
|---|---|---|
| Scale on appliances and pipes | Yes, removes hardness | No |
| Spots on dishes and glassware | Yes | No |
| Dry skin and hair from hard water | Yes | No |
| Chlorine or chloramine taste and odor | No | Yes, carbon stage |
| Disinfection byproducts (TTHMs, HAAs) | No | Yes, carbon stage |
| Sediment and particulates | No | Yes, sediment pre-filter |
| Chromium-6 | No | Partially (RO is more effective) |
For Indianapolis homeowners at 17 GPG who are also concerned about chloramine taste and disinfection byproducts, the right answer is usually both systems working together. This is not upselling: they address genuinely different problems and neither one duplicates the other. Combined system: filtration plus softening
When a whole home filter and a water softener are installed together, the treatment order matters. The correct sequence for Indianapolis municipal water is:
- Sediment pre-filter: catches particulates before they reach either treatment unit.
- Whole home carbon filter: removes chloramines and byproducts. Placing the carbon filter before the softener protects the resin bed from chloramine degradation over time. Chloramines can damage ion-exchange resin; removing them upstream extends the softener resin's service life.
- Water softener: removes calcium and magnesium from already-filtered water.
- Reverse osmosis at point of use (optional): typically under the kitchen sink, for drinking and cooking water. Removes any remaining dissolved solids, chromium-6, nitrates, and provides near-pure water for drinking.

Each city has slightly different water chemistry, which affects system sizing and media selection. Indianapolis and Carmel use chloramine disinfection, which requires catalytic carbon rather than standard GAC for effective removal. Noblesville and Westfield use free chlorine, where standard carbon performs well. We test your specific tap before recommending anything.

What is the difference between a water softener and a water filter?
A water softener uses ion exchange to remove calcium and magnesium (hardness) from the water. It does not remove chlorine, byproducts, sediment, or chemical contaminants. A whole home water filter, typically a multi-stage carbon system, removes chlorine or chloramines, taste and odor compounds, sediment, and some chemical contaminants. It does not soften the water. Indianapolis homeowners at 17 GPG often benefit from both: the softener protects appliances and plumbing from scale, while the carbon filter addresses the chemical treatment Citizens Energy uses for disinfection. How often does a whole home water filter need to be serviced in Indianapolis?
Whole home carbon filters serving Indianapolis water typically need cartridge replacement every 6 to 12 months depending on flow rate, household size, and source water quality. Sediment pre-filters in front of carbon media often need replacement every 3 to 6 months.
